How much is road tax on a BMW 5 Series?
Most used BMW 5 Series in stock pay the flat standard rate of £200 a year — 50% were first registered on or after 1 April 2017, when road tax became a single annual rate regardless of CO₂. Figures are for the 2026/27 UK tax year.

When budgeting for a pre-owned 5 Series, understanding Vehicle Excise Duty (VED), commonly known as road tax, is crucial. In the UK, VED for used cars is determined by the car's first-registration date, its CO2 emissions, and its fuel type. This means that two identical models could have different tax rates if they were first registered on different dates. For BMW 5 Series models registered before April 2017, VED is calculated based purely on their CO2 emissions banding. Lower CO2 output typically results in lower annual road tax. However, for 5 Series cars first registered from April 2017 onwards, the system changes significantly. These vehicles incur a first-year VED rate, followed by a standard flat rate for subsequent years. Additionally, cars with an original list price exceeding £40,000 are subject to a 'premium' surcharge for five years from the second time the vehicle is taxed. It is important to note that the VED exemption for fully-electric vehicles is also changing in the near future. Cars registered from 1 Apr 2017 (2026/27)
50% of BMW 5 Series
If over £40k new · years 2–6
| CO₂ | Petrol / EV / RDE2 diesel | Non-RDE2 diesel |
|---|---|---|
| 0 g/km | £10 | £10 |
| 1–50 g/km | £115 | £135 |
| 51–75 g/km | £135 | £280 |
| 76–90 g/km | £280 | £365 |
| 91–100 g/km | £365 | £405 |
| 101–110 g/km | £405 | £455 |
| 111–130 g/km | £455 | £560 |
| 131–150 g/km | £560 | £1,410 |
| 151–170 g/km | £1,410 | £2,270 |
| 171–190 g/km | £2,270 | £3,420 |
| 191–225 g/km | £3,420 | £4,850 |
| 226–255 g/km | £4,850 | £5,690 |
| Over 255 g/km | £5,690 | £5,690 |
Rates shown are for the 2026/27 UK tax year (source: DVLA / GOV.UK). Check the exact figure for a specific car by its registration on the GOV.UK vehicle-tax service.
